Plague and the Athenian Imagination

- Drama, History, and the Cult of Asclepius

Om Plague and the Athenian Imagination

This book investigates the effect of the great plague of Athens that began in 430 BCE on the imagination of its literary artists and on the social imagination of the city as a whole. It proposes a significant relationship between the new Temple of Asclepius and the Theater of Dionysus.
